Rig Veda 2.30.8 — Indra and Others

Verse 8 of 11 from Sukta 2.30 (Indra and Others) in Mandala 2 of the Rig Veda.

Rig Veda 2.30.8

Sanskrit (Devanagari)

सरस्वति तवमस्मानविड्ढि मरुत्वती धर्षती जेषि शत्रून | तयं चिच्छर्धन्तं तविषीयमाणमिन्द्रो हन्ति वर्षभं शण्डिकानाम

IAST Romanisation

sarasvati tvamasmānaviḍḍhi marutvatī dhṛṣatī jeṣi śatrūn | tyaṃ cicchardhantaṃ taviṣīyamāṇamindro hanti vṛṣabhaṃ śaṇḍikānām

English Translation (Griffith)

Sarasvatī, protect us: with the Maruts allied thou boldly conquerest our foemen, While Indra does to death the daring chieftain of Śaṇḍikas exulting in his prowess.
